Abstract

PROBLEM TO BE SOLVED: To provide a butt end of an inlet and a holding device for the butt end capable of easily carrying out an adhering work without requiring screwing, with which any remaining portion of the pouring pipe cut off on the job site can be utilized for another inlet. SOLUTION: A fixed plate portion to be attached to a mouth of an inlet, a socket portion to which a pouring hose and a pouring pipe can be attached, and a check valve attached to the socket portion; the fixed plate portion and the socket portion can be formed in one united body; and the socket portion comprises a pouring hose attaching portion provided with a female threaded portion and a pouring pipe attaching portion having no threaded portion arranged oppositely each other.
